I've worn countless jerseys throughout my playing days, and I can tell you firsthand that the wrong fabric or fit can absolutely impact your game. The 2024 Umbro jerseys address this with what they're calling "Dynamic Performance Mesh" - a material that feels noticeably lighter than previous versions while providing better moisture management. During my test wears, I found the ventilation zones strategically placed in high-sweat areas particularly effective, keeping me comfortable through intense sessions. The cut has also been refined to allow for greater range of motion, something I wish I'd had during my competitive playing days when stiff jerseys would sometimes restrict my movement during crucial plays.
Now let's talk deals because let's be honest, authentic soccer jerseys don't come cheap. Through my connections in the soccer retail space, I've learned that Umbro USA is positioning their 2024 jerseys at a slightly lower price point than their main competitors - we're looking at approximately $85 for replica versions and $145 for authentic player-grade versions compared to Nike's $90 and $160 respectively. What makes this particularly interesting is that you're not sacrificing quality for the lower price. The stitching on the badges and logos feels more durable than what I've seen on some recent Adidas releases, and the fabric has this satisfying thickness to it that suggests it'll withstand multiple seasons of wear and washing. I've personally put one through five wash cycles already, and the colors remain vibrant with no noticeable shrinkage or fading.
The design philosophy behind the 2024 collection seems to draw inspiration from both classic American sports aesthetics and modern soccer culture. I'm particularly fond of the home jersey's subtle patterning that echoes traditional American quilt designs - it's a nod to heritage that doesn't scream for attention but adds depth to the overall look. The away kit takes a bolder approach with what appears to be gradient coloring that transitions from deep navy to electric blue, reminiscent of twilight sky transitions. Having seen both in person, I can confirm the digital renders don't do justice to how these jerseys actually look under different lighting conditions. There's a dimensionality to the patterns that only becomes apparent when you see the fabric moving with the body.
